#346b60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#346b60 is composed of 20.4% red, 42%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.3%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 168 degrees, a saturation of 34.6% and a lightness of 31.2%. #346b60 color hex could be obtained by blending #68d6c0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#346b60 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#346b60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#346b60 has RGB values of R:52, G:107,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 3435360.
